首页/科普/正文
pc_dmis编程实例

 2024年05月15日  阅读 39  评论 0

摘要:###DMIS编程命令DimensionalMeasuringInterfaceStandard(DMIS)是一种用于计量设备的编程语言和接口标准。它允许用户编写测量程序,并与各种测量设备(如坐标测量

DMIS编程命令

Dimensional Measuring Interface Standard (DMIS) 是一种用于计量设备的编程语言和接口标准。它允许用户编写测量程序,并与各种测量设备(如坐标测量机)进行通信和控制。以下是一些常见的DMIS编程命令和示例:

1. 测量命令

MOVE命令

: 用于控制测头移动到指定位置。

```dmis

MOVE/CART, X1,Y1,Z1

```

MOVE命令(旋转)

: 用于控制测头沿指定轴旋转到指定角度。

```dmis

MOVE/ROTARY, A1

```

MEASUREMENT命令

: 用于执行实际的测量并记录结果。

```dmis

MEASUREMENT/FEATURE CIRCLE1

```

2. 几何构造命令

POINT命令

: 定义一个点的坐标。

```dmis

POINT/XYZ, 100,150,200

```

LINE命令

: 定义一条直线。

```dmis

LINE/END, POINT1, POINT2

```

CIRCLE命令

: 定义一个圆。

```dmis

CIRCLE/CENTER, POINT1, NOMINAL, 50

```

3. 控制流命令

IF条件语句

: 根据条件执行不同的操作。

```dmis

IF/GTH, FEATURE1, FEATURE2

```

DO循环

: 重复执行指定的操作。

```dmis

DO/NUM, 5, MEASUREMENT/FEATURE CIRCLE1

```

WHILE循环

: 在满足条件的情况下重复执行操作。

```dmis

WHILE/AND, ERROR1, LESSTHAN, 0.1, MEASUREMENT/FEATURE CIRCLE1

```

4. 数据处理命令

ASSIGN命令

: 将数值赋给变量。

```dmis

ASSIGN/VALUE, 10, TO, VARIABLE1

```

CALC命令

: 执行数学运算。

```dmis

CALC/VARIABLE1 = VARIABLE2 20

```

5. 输出命令

REPORT命令

: 生成测量报告。

```dmis

REPORT/FILE, 'C:\Reports\measurement_report.txt'

```

以上是一些常见的DMIS编程命令,通过组合和调整这些命令,可以编写复杂的测量程序,以满足特定的测量需求。

希望以上信息对您有所帮助,如果您需要更深入的了解或有其他问题,请随时提问。

版权声明:本文为 “联成科技技术有限公司” 原创文章,转载请附上原文出处链接及本声明;

原文链接:https://lckjcn.com/post/30968.html

  • 文章48019
  • 评论0
  • 浏览13708654
关于 我们
免责声明:本网站部分内容由用户自行上传,若侵犯了您的权益,请联系我们处理,谢谢! 沪ICP备2023034384号-10
免责声明:本网站部分内容由用户自行上传,若侵犯了您的权益,请联系我们处理,谢谢! 沪ICP备2023034384号-10 网站地图